The clipper ship the Carrier Pigeon was on its maiden voyage from Boston to San Francisco and had traveled more than 15,000 miles after rounding Cape Horn at the southernmost tip of South America and heading back north again. The caves of Pigeon Point in particular became a popular spot for rum runners to stash their goods.When Prohibition started, the boundary of where international waters started was 3 miles offshore, so it became a popular way for coastal boat owners to make money. "It took four shipwrecks along the same section of the treacherous San Mateo County coast in the years between 1853 and 1868 before the lighthouse was finally funded and built, according to "Shipwrecks, Scalawags, and Scavengers: The Storied Waters of Pigeon Point," a 2007 book by maritime historian JoAnn Semones, a docent at Pigeon Point Light Station State Historic Park.The first of those shipwrecks, on June 6, 1853, gave Pigeon Point its name.
